What is the best way to clean cane furniture? How To Clean Natural Rattan And Cane Conservatory FurnitureMake up a solution of washing-up liquid and tepid water.Stir vigorously to make a lot of suds.Dip a soft clean cloth in the suds.Gently wipe the furniture without getting it too wet.You may have to use a toothbrush to get in-between the weave.

What removes oil based stain?

What removes oil based stain? Your best bets are liquid laundry detergent or a great liquid dish soap. These are born grease fighters. You can also put a paste of baking soda on the stained area to try to draw up some of the oil. A gel stain remover is another great option since it penetrates well into all the fibers of the clothing.

Do baby oil stains come out?

Do baby oil stains come out? What is the best way to remove baby oil from clothing? For stains that are concentrated oils, you can pre-treat with a small amount of liquid dishwashing detergent (like Dawn). Apply it directly to the stain, rub it in and then wait 5 minutes.

How do you clean a fabric stained couch?

How do you clean a fabric stained couch? Create a cleaning solution by combining equal parts water and white vinegar in a small bucket. Dip a microfiber cloth into the solution so that it is damp but not wet. Wipe the couch, rinsing the cloth regularly. Dry the couch with a clean, dry microfiber cloth.

How do you get dried pet stains out of carpet?

How do you get dried pet stains out of carpet? To get pet stains out of carpet areas, make a solution of ½ cup vinegar, 2 cups water, 1 tablespoon dish detergent, and 1 tablespoon of salt. Apply this solution to the stained area with a sponge or washcloth. Blot with a dry towel and repeat the process if necessary.

How do you get stains out of Sunbrella fabric? According to Sunbrella, 98% of stains can easily be removed by spraying on a cleaning solution of water and mild soap directly to the stain and using a soft bristle brush to clean. Yes, it is that simple! For those remaining 2% of stubborn stains, try using a diluted bleach/soap mixture and spot clean.

How do you get yellow stains out of dress shirts?

How do you get yellow stains out of dress shirts? Soak the stained part of the shirt in water containing three percent hydrogen peroxide. Leave it for approximately half an hour then wash as usual. Hydrogen peroxide should be rinsed off thoroughly as any traces of it that remain will turn yellow when the shirt is exposed to sunlight.

How do you remove pen ink from fabric?

How do you remove pen ink from fabric? Place a paper towel under the stain and sponge it with rubbing alcohol. Use an eyedropper to apply alcohol directly onto the stain or, for a larger spot, pour the alcohol into a small dish, immerse the stained area and soak for 15 minutes. The ink should begin to dissolve almost immediately.
